This property occupies an enviable position within the South Bank area of York and is only a short amble away from a quality local butcher, baker, local convenience shops as well as an array of independent coffee shops, restaurants and bars on Bishopthorpe Road. The area mainly consists of late 19th Century residential terrace housing, with many of the original corner shops, public houses, churches and schools surviving into the 21st century contributing to the communal value and sense of place.
The green open spaces of the Knavesmire and Rowntree Park are nearb, and the districts of Fishergate and Fulford can be easily accessed over Millennium Bridge. The city centre and railway station are around a 20 minute walk away and can also be accessed from Bishopthorpe Road where a bus service regularly runs.
Knavesmire Primary School is the main primary school in the area. The secondary schools of Millthorpe School and All Saints RC School are also nearby.
